1. What is the purpose of a security forces patrol? a) To check weather
conditions
B. To enforce security policies and monitor potential threats
C. To monitor civilian vehicles in the area
D. To provide transportation for leadership
Answer: b) To enforce security policies and monitor potential threats
Rationale: The role of a patrol is to actively monitor the base and
surrounding areas to identify security threats, enforce regulations, and
maintain situational awareness.


2. Which of the following is considered a restricted area? a) Air traffic
control towers
B. Dining facilities
C. Open fields
D. Public roads near the base
Answer: a) Air traffic control towers
Rationale: Restricted areas are those with heightened security due to
the presence of sensitive operations, such as air traffic control towers,
where access is limited to authorized personnel.

,3. What should a security forces member do if they are threatened by
an individual with a weapon?
A. Immediately use force to neutralize the threat
B. Call for backup and attempt to de-escalate the situation
C. Ignore the threat and continue with duties
D. Withdraw and wait for orders from a superior officer
Answer: b) Call for backup and attempt to de-escalate the situation
Rationale: In a threatening situation, security forces should attempt to
de-escalate the situation while requesting backup for additional
support. Deadly force should only be used if absolutely necessary.


4. What does the term "use of force continuum" refer to? a) The steps
involved in conducting a criminal investigation
B. The levels of force a security forces member can apply based on the
situation
C. The policy for protecting classified documents
D. A procedure for handling detainees
Answer: b) The levels of force a security forces member can apply based
on the situation
Rationale: The use of force continuum provides a framework that helps
security forces members determine the appropriate level of force to
apply depending on the severity of the threat encountered.

, 5. What should a security forces member do when encountering a
civilian unauthorized to be on the base? a) Ignore the civilian and
continue with duties
B. Direct the civilian to the nearest exit
C. Immediately arrest the civilian
D. Approach the civilian and ask for identification and the reason for
entry
Answer: d) Approach the civilian and ask for identification and the
reason for entry
Rationale: A security forces member must approach the individual,
verify their identity, and determine their reason for being on base. This
ensures the security of the installation.


6. What is the purpose of a “post order” in security forces operations?
A. To assign officers to their patrol routes
B. To outline the duties, responsibilities, and expectations of an
individual guard post
C. To track the movements of visitors entering the base
D. To document the amount of time a guard has been on duty
Answer: b) To outline the duties, responsibilities, and expectations of
an individual guard post
Rationale: Post orders are issued to security forces to define their
specific duties, the protocols to follow, and the actions to take while
stationed at a particular post.
